Can you guys explain the importance of priming the pad, and do you think feel that it`s necessary when polishing? I`m gonna be polishing soon, and I`m trying to learn some more info..

imported_rydawg
05-21-2007, 09:45 PM
Priming the pad will make the pad not jump and skip on the rotory. It will also make the polish flow better into the pad and even it out giving it a well balance and full coverage of the entire pad instead of just the spot where the polish was applied
